Relocation pioneer awaits rest of clothing industry's arrival
Chen Bingliu relocated his dressmaking company from Beijing to Hebei province's Yongqing county in July, getting ahead of the government's plan to move clothing manufacturing and other industries out of the capital.
He found being among the first to relocate to a development zone about 40 km south of Beijing had its benefits and drawbacks. Some of his costs were lower, but he encountered challenging transportation and worker recruitment issues.
Chen first considered relocating his Beijing Yingke Clothing in 2009. He bought the land and started factory construction the next year. "Though relocation was not compulsory at the time, I knew it was a trend for the noncapital industries, such as clothing manufacturing and wholesale markets, to move out of the capital," he said.
